Trauma and Transcendence
- James Finley's earliest memory involves praying to God for strength amidst his father's violence.
- He felt God took him to a "secret place," offering solace despite continued trauma.
Entering Gethsemani
- Upon entering the monastery, Finley was interviewed by the novice master, abbot, and a psychiatrist.
- He was drawn to the chanting of vespers in Latin, finding it archetypal and profound.
Meeting Merton
- Finley's voice shook when he first met Merton due to his issues with authority figures.
- Merton's compassionate response involved daily talks about the pig barn, leveling the playing field.
